各位老铁们,大家好,今天由我来为大家分享JS怎样为style动态加载CSS文件,以及js动态加载div的相关问题知识,希望对大家有所帮助。如果可以帮助到大家,还望关注收藏下本站,您的支持是我们最大的动力,谢谢大家了哈,下面我们开始吧!
请问如何用修改CSS文件里的代码?
如果你想通过JavaScript修改CSS文件中的代码,实际上可以直接操作DOM样式属性,而无需直接修改CSS文件。具体来说,可以通过JavaScript动态地改变元素的样式。例如,你可以使用 element.style.propertyName = value;这样的语法来改变元素的样式属性。
在JavaScript中,我们可以使用jQuery库来动态地修改CSS样式。例如,我们有如下代码:这是一个简单的jQuery选择器,用于选择所有元素。然后,我们使用each函数遍历这些元素。在遍历过程中,我们检查每个元素的value属性是否等于mm。如果是,则给该元素添加class。这里,我们使用了addClass方法来实现。
通过JavaScript来修改CSS属性,使用jQuery可以非常方便地实现,例如:$(img).css(border-color,red); 这段代码可以将所有图片的边框颜色更改为红色。下面是针对此问题的一个测试页面示例:该页面包含三张图片,它们的默认样式为边框宽度10px,边框样式为实线,边框颜色为灰色。
首先,可以直接改变元素的样式属性。例如,如果你想要改变一个id为obj的元素的背景颜色,可以使用以下代码:document.getElementById(obj).style.backgroundColor=#003366其次,可以通过改变元素的class属性来实现样式改变。
JavaScript 通过类名修改 CSS 样式主要分为两步:在 CSS 中定义类样式和在 JavaScript 中操作类名。首先,CSS 中定义类样式。例如:Copy code .my-class { font-size: 16px;color: red;} 接着,使用 JavaScript 获取元素并操作类名。
margin-top: 100px;或者padding-top:100px;以上两种方式是改变是上边距的方法。可以去试试。
js怎样动态调用外部CSS?
1、在JavaScript中,我们可以使用jQuery库来动态地修改CSS样式。例如,我们有如下代码:这是一个简单的jQuery选择器,用于选择所有元素。然后,我们使用each函数遍历这些元素。在遍历过程中,我们检查每个元素的value属性是否等于mm。如果是,则给该元素添加class。这里,我们使用了addClass方法来实现。
2、在JavaScript项目中,动态添加CSS样式主要利用JavaScript对DOM元素进行操作。方法一:创建新的样式表。
3、调用文件也非常直接。同样地,在HTML代码中,你可以在或标签内使用标签来引用外部的文件。比如: 这行代码会使浏览器从指定路径加载文件,并在页面加载时执行该文件中的代码。以上步骤是导入外部CSS和文件的基本方法。遵循这些步骤,你可以确保你的网页样式和功能得以正确地呈现和运作。
4、使用JavaScript动态设置CSS样式有多种方式,以下是八种常见的方法:直接设置style属性:通过JavaScript直接修改DOM元素的style属性。例如,element.style.color = red;。如果属性名包含,如fontsize,需使用驼峰命名法或中括号形式。
5、CSS的链接格式主要通过在HTML文档的部分使用标签来实现。其基本语法如下:。其中,标签的rel属性设置为stylesheet,type属性设置为text/css,href属性则指定了外部样式表文件的路径。通过这种方式,外部CSS文件可以被正确引入到HTML文档中。
获取CSS动态ID并增加一个style
div class=div id=0 style=position: fixed;z-index: 2147483646;left: 0px;width: 100%;text-align: center;bottom: -5px; background:red;/div//上面的样式,修改了一下,加了一个class和设置了一个背景图。
通过设置element.style.cssText = property1: value1; property2: value2;可以一次性设置多个样式属性。创建并引入新的CSS样式文件:适用于需要动态添加大量样式规则的场景。可以通过JavaScript动态创建一个style元素,并将其添加到head中。
//先获取dom节点 var a = document.getElementById(id);a.style.color=red; //改变颜色 这行代码将id为id的元素字体颜色设置为红色。
第六种方法是使用设置CSSText属性,这种方式较为灵活,可以一次性设置多个样式。第七种方法是创建并引入新的CSS样式文件,这种方式适用于需要动态添加大量样式规则的场景。最后一种方法是使用addRule、insertRule函数,这些函数允许在CSS规则集中动态添加新的规则。
js提供了一个内置的指令v-bind:style,可以用来动态地绑定CSS样式。它允许你使用JavaScript表达式来控制元素的样式,而不是使用静态的字符串。v-for是vue.js中的指令,用于遍历数组或对象中的数据,动态添加dom。使用v-for指令时,需要提供一个数组或对象,它会根据提供的数据来渲染相应的dom结构。
首先,可以直接改变元素的样式属性。例如,如果你想要改变一个id为obj的元素的背景颜色,可以使用以下代码:document.getElementById(obj).style.backgroundColor=#003366其次,可以通过改变元素的class属性来实现样式改变。
关于JS怎样为style动态加载CSS文件到此分享完毕,希望能帮助到您。